Ingredients:

  • 1 pound Bulk Breakfast Sausage: I usually go for a mild variety, but if you love a kick, feel free to use spicy! Make sure it’s in bulk form, not links.
  • 8-10 slices Day-Old Bread: My go-to is usually white bread or a soft wheat bread, but a sturdy sourdough or challah can also work beautifully for this Savory Breakfast Sausage Casserole Recipe Easy. Day-old bread is key because it absorbs the egg mixture without becoming mushy.
  • 1 medium Yellow Onion: Diced finely to distribute its aromatic flavor throughout the casserole.
  • 1 Bell Pepper: Any color works – red, yellow, or orange adds a lovely sweetness and vibrant color. Green bell pepper offers a slightly more robust, less sweet flavor. Diced small.
  • 1 cup Shredded Cheese: Cheddar is a classic for a reason, but a blend of cheddar and Monterey Jack, or even a sharp provolone, can elevate the flavor. I often use sharp cheddar for an extra zing.
  • 1 cup Milk: Whole milk offers the richest texture, but 2% or even a non-dairy milk like almond or soy will work if that’s what you have on hand.
  • 6 Large Eggs: The binding power of our casserole, providing structure and protein.
  • 2 cloves Garlic: Minced, for that essential savory depth.
  • 1 tablespoon Olive Oil or Butter: For sautéing our vegetables and sausage.
  • 1 teaspoon Dried Mustard: This secret ingredient truly enhances the savory notes of the sausage and cheese. Don’t skip it!
  • ½ teaspoon Garlic Powder: Even though we’re using fresh garlic, a touch of powder really boosts that classic savory flavor.
  • ½ teaspoon Onion Powder: Another layer of savory goodness.
  • ¼ teaspoon Black Pepper: Freshly ground is always best!
  • ½ teaspoon Salt: Or to taste, keeping in mind the saltiness of the sausage and cheese.
  • Optional: ¼ teaspoon Red Pepper Flakes: If you want to add a subtle heat to your Savory Breakfast Sausage Casserole Recipe Easy.
  • Optional: ½ cup Fresh Spinach: Roughly chopped, for a little extra color and nutrition. I love adding this for a fresh contrast.

Preparation Phase: Bringing the Flavors Together

Before we even think about assembly, there are a few crucial steps to get our ingredients ready. Trust me, taking your time here will make all the difference in achieving that perfect, comforting Savory Breakfast Sausage Casserole Recipe Easy.

  1. Prepare the Bread: First things first, let’s get that bread ready. I usually grab my day-old bread and cut it into roughly 1-inch cubes. You want pieces that are substantial enough to hold their shape but small enough to be easily scoopable. If your bread isn’t day-old, don’t fret! You can lightly toast the cubes on a baking sheet in a 300°F (150°C) oven for about 10-15 minutes, or until they’re slightly crisp. This step is super important because it prevents your casserole from becoming soggy. A firm foundation is key for any great casserole! Once cubed, set them aside in a large bowl.
  2. Cook the Sausage: Now for the star of the show! Heat 1 tablespoon of olive oil or butter in a large skillet or frying pan over medium-high heat. Once hot, crumble the bulk breakfast sausage into the pan. I use a wooden spoon or spatula to break it up into small pieces as it cooks. Stir frequently, making sure to brown it evenly on all sides. You’re looking for that lovely golden-brown color, with no pink remaining. This usually takes about 7-10 minutes. Once cooked, use a slotted spoon to transfer the sausage to a paper towel-lined plate. This allows any excess grease to drain off, which is essential for a delicious, not oily, casserole. Leave about 1 tablespoon of the rendered sausage fat in the skillet – it’s packed with flavor!
  3. Sauté the Aromatics: Reduce the heat to medium. Add the diced yellow onion and bell pepper to the skillet with the remaining sausage fat. Sauté for about 5-7 minutes, stirring occasionally, until the vegetables have softened and the onion is translucent. They should be fragrant and slightly tender. Next, add the minced garlic to the skillet and cook for just another minute until it’s fragrant. You don’t want the garlic to burn, so keep a close eye on it! If you’re using fresh spinach, this is the time to add it to the skillet. Stir it in and cook just until it wilts, which only takes about 1-2 minutes. Once done, remove the skillet from the heat.

Crafting the Egg Custard: The Heart of Your Casserole

The egg custard is what brings all our wonderful ingredients together into a cohesive, comforting dish. This mixture needs to be perfectly seasoned to complement the savory sausage and cheese. It’s a simple step, but one that demands a bit of attention to detail.

  1. Whisk the Eggs: In a large mixing bowl, crack your 6 large eggs. Using a whisk, beat them vigorously until the yolks and whites are fully combined and slightly frothy. You want a uniform yellow color, ensuring no streaks of egg white remain. This aeration helps create a lighter, fluffier texture in your final casserole.
  2. Add the Dairy and Seasonings: Pour in the 1 cup of milk with the whisked eggs. Now, let’s layer in those delicious seasonings: add the dried mustard, garlic powder, onion powder, black pepper, and salt. If you’re feeling adventurous and want a little warmth, now is the time to add those optional red pepper flakes. Whisk everything together thoroughly until all the spices are fully incorporated and dissolved into the liquid. Give it a taste – you want it to be well-seasoned, as the bread will absorb a lot of the flavor.

Assembling the Savory Breakfast Sausage Casserole Recipe Easy: Layers of Deliciousness

This is where everything comes together! Proper layering ensures every bite of your Savory Breakfast Sausage Casserole Recipe Easy is packed with flavor and texture. It’s a bit like building a delicious lasagna, but for breakfast!

  1. Prepare Your Baking Dish: First, lightly grease a 9×13-inch baking dish with butter or cooking spray. I like to use a non-stick spray for easy cleanup, especially with cheese involved.
  2. Layer the Bread: Scatter about half of your cubed bread evenly across the bottom of the prepared baking dish. This creates our base layer, ready to soak up all that eggy goodness.
  3. Add the Sausage and Veggies: Evenly distribute all the cooked breakfast sausage over the bread cubes. Then, sprinkle the sautéed onion, bell pepper, and garlic (and spinach, if using) over the sausage layer. Try to get an even spread so you get a bit of everything in each bite.
  4. Sprinkle with Cheese: Now, sprinkle about half of the shredded cheese over the sausage and vegetable layer. This creates a lovely cheesy pocket throughout the casserole.
  5. Top with More Bread: Layer the remaining bread cubes over the cheese. This forms the final bread layer before we add the custard.
  6. Pour the Egg Custard: Carefully and slowly pour the prepared egg and milk mixture evenly over everything in the baking dish. Take your time to ensure all the bread cubes are saturated. I like to gently press down on the bread with the back of a spoon to help it absorb the liquid. You want every single piece of bread to be thoroughly soaked; this is crucial for a moist, flavorful casserole.
  7. Final Cheese Layer: Sprinkle the remaining shredded cheese over the top of the casserole. This will melt into a beautiful golden crust as it bakes.
  8. The Overnight Soak (Highly Recommended!): For the absolute best results with your Savory Breakfast Sausage Casserole Recipe Easy, I highly recommend covering the baking dish tightly with plastic wrap and refrigerating it for at least 4 hours, or even better, overnight. This resting period allows the bread to fully absorb the egg mixture, ensuring a uniformly moist and flavorful casserole. It also makes your morning much easier, as the prep work is already done!

Baking Instructions: Achieving Golden Perfection

Baking is the grand finale, where all our carefully prepared ingredients transform into a bubbly, golden-brown masterpiece. Getting the timing and temperature right is essential for a perfectly cooked casserole.

  1. Preheat Your Oven: If you’ve refrigerated your casserole, make sure to pull it out of the fridge at least 30 minutes before baking to allow it to come closer to room temperature.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C).
  2. Prepare for Baking: Remove the plastic wrap from the casserole dish. If you notice any dry spots on the bread, you can gently press them down into the egg mixture again.
  3. Initial Bake: Place the casserole dish in the preheated oven. Bake for 30 minutes. At this point, the edges should start to bubble, and the cheese will be melting beautifully.
  4. Cover and Continue Baking: After 30 minutes, if the top is browning too quickly, loosely tent the casserole dish with aluminum foil. This prevents the cheese from over-browning while the interior finishes cooking. Continue baking for another 20-30 minutes, or until the center is set. A great trick to check for doneness is to insert a knife into the center; if it comes out clean, your casserole is ready! The internal temperature should reach 160°F (71°C).
  5. Rest Before Serving: Once baked, carefully remove the casserole from the oven. Resist the urge to dive in immediately! Let the casserole rest for at least 10-15 minutes before serving. This resting period allows the egg custard to fully set and makes for much cleaner slices. Plus, it gives it a moment to cool down slightly so you don’t burn your tongue on that first delicious bite.

Serving Suggestions and Helpful Tips for Your Savory Breakfast Sausage Casserole Recipe Easy

Your beautiful Savory Breakfast Sausage Casserole Recipe Easy is now ready to be enjoyed! Here are a few ideas to make the most of it, whether you’re serving a crowd or just enjoying a quiet morning.

  1. Classic Pairings: This casserole is hearty enough to be a complete meal on its own, but it also pairs wonderfully with a side of fresh fruit salad, a dollop of sour cream or Greek yogurt, or even a drizzle of your favorite hot sauce for an extra kick. A simple green salad can also be a refreshing contrast, especially if you’re serving it for brunch.
  2. Make-Ahead Magic: As mentioned, this is an ideal make-ahead dish. Prepare it the night before, cover, and refrigerate. Just remember to add about 10-15 minutes to the total baking time if baking straight from the fridge. Bringing it to room temperature for 30 minutes before baking helps ensure even cooking.
  3. Storage: Leftovers of this Savory Breakfast Sausage Casserole Recipe Easy store beautifully! Once completely cooled, cover the dish tightly with plastic wrap or transfer individual portions to airtight containers. It will keep in the refrigerator for up to 3-4 days.
  4. Reheating: To reheat individual portions, I usually pop them in the microwave for 1-2 minutes until heated through. For a larger portion or the whole casserole, cover it with foil and reheat in a 300°F (150°C) oven until warmed through, about 20-30 minutes.
  5. Customization is Key: Don’t be afraid to make this recipe your own!
    • Cheese Variations: Experiment with different cheeses like gruyere, mozzarella, or pepper jack for different flavor profiles.
    • Vegetable Boost: Sautéed mushrooms, chopped green chilies, or even leftover roasted vegetables can be a fantastic addition.
    • Spice It Up: A pinch of cayenne pepper, a dash of smoked paprika, or a sprinkle of Italian seasoning can totally change the character of the casserole.
    • Gluten-Free Option: Simply swap out the regular bread for your favorite gluten-free bread. The results are just as delicious!
  6. Preventing Soggy Bottoms: The key to avoiding a soggy casserole is using day-old or lightly toasted bread and ensuring it’s thoroughly soaked in the egg mixture. Also, remember to drain off excess fat from the sausage. These small steps guarantee a perfectly textured Savory Breakfast Sausage Casserole Recipe Easy every time.

Ingredients

  • 1 pound Beef Breakfast Sausage
  • 1 refrigerated crescent roll dough sheet
  • 1 medium yellow onion, diced
  • 1 bell pepper, diced
  • 2 cups cheddar cheese, shredded
  • 1 cup whole milk
  • 6 large eggs
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 tbsp olive oil or butter
  • 1 tsp dried mustard
  • ½ tsp dried minced garlic
  • ½ tsp dried minced onion
  • ½ tsp black pepper
  • ½ tsp sea salt
  • Optional: ¼ tsp red pepper flakes
  • Optional: ½ cup fresh spinach, chopped

Instructions

  1. Step 1
    Cook 1 lb beef breakfast sausage in 1 tbsp oil/butter over medium-high heat, crumbling until browned (7-10 min). Drain excess fat, leaving 1 tbsp in pan. Set sausage aside.
  2. Step 2
    Add diced onion and bell pepper to the skillet; sauté until softened (5-7 min). Stir in minced fresh garlic (1 min), then optional chopped spinach until wilted (1-2 min). Remove from heat.
  3. Step 3
    In a large bowl, whisk 6 large eggs and 1 cup whole milk vigorously. Whisk in 1 tsp dried mustard, ½ tsp dried minced garlic, ½ tsp dried minced onion, ½ tsp black pepper, ½ tsp sea salt, and optional ¼ tsp red pepper flakes until fully combined.
  4. Step 4
    Lightly grease a 9×13-inch baking dish. Unroll the crescent roll dough sheet and press it evenly into the bottom and slightly up the sides of the dish.
  5. Step 5
    Layer the cooked beef sausage and sautéed vegetables evenly over the crescent roll dough. Sprinkle 1 cup of the shredded cheddar cheese over these layers.
  6. Step 6
    Carefully pour the prepared egg custard evenly over everything in the dish. Top with the remaining 1 cup of shredded cheddar cheese.
  7. Step 7
    For best results (and an easier morning), cover the baking dish tightly with plastic wrap and refrigerate for at least 4 hours or overnight.
  8. Step 8
    Preheat oven to 375°F (190°C). If the casserole was refrigerated, remove it 30 minutes before baking to allow it to come closer to room temperature. Remove plastic wrap.
  9. Step 9
    Bake for 30 minutes. If the top is browning too quickly, loosely tent the casserole dish with aluminum foil. Continue baking for another 20-30 minutes, or until the center is set and a knife inserted comes out clean (internal temperature 160°F/71°C).
  10. Step 10
    Remove the casserole from the oven and let it rest for 10-15 minutes before slicing and serving. This allows the custard to set for cleaner slices.
